@charset "utf-8";
/* CSS Document */

.contactform{}
.contactform div{margin-bottom:10px;}
.contactform fieldset{border:0px solid #036; width:60%; -moz-border-radius:.8em; -webkit-border-radius:.8em; border-radius:.8em;}
.contactform legend{color:#036; font-weight:bold; font-size:12px;}
.contactform input{border:1px solid #036; width:50%; -moz-box-shadow:2px 2px 3px rgba(0,0,0,0.5); -webkit-box-shadow:2px 2px 3px rgba(0,0,0,0.5); box-shadow:2px 2px 3px rgba(0,0,0,0.5); -moz-border-radius:.5em; -webkit-border-radius:.5em; border-radius:.5em;}
.contactform button{border:1px solid #666; background:#036; color:#fff; -moz-border-radius:.8em; -webkit-border-radius:.8em; border-radius:.8em; -moz-box-shadow:1px 1px 3px rgba(0,0,0,0.5); -webkit-box-shadow:1px 1px 3px rgba(0,0,0,0.5); box-shadow:1px 1px 3px rgba(0,0,0,0.5);}
.contactform label{display:block;}
.contactform textarea{border:1px solid #036; width:100%; height:180px; -moz-box-shadow:2px 2px 3px rgba(0,0,0,0.5); -moz-border-radius:.5em; -webkit-border-radius:.5em; border-radius:.5em;}

#contactmsg p{margin:20px 0px; padding:10px; -moz-box-shadow:2px 2px 3px rgba(0,0,0,0.5); -webkit-box-shadow:2px 2px 3px rgba(0,0,0,0.5); box-shadow:2px 2px 3px rgba(0,0,0,0.5); -moz-border-radius:.5em; -webkit-border-radius:.5em; border-radius:.5em; text-align:center;}
p.success{background:#B7FFB7; border:1px solid #060; color:#060;}
p.failure{background:#FCC; border:1px solid #F00; color:#F00;}
